China to deepen ties with Pakistan to promote BRI
BEIJING: China vowed to further deepen its ties with Pakistan and other friendly countries to promote implementation of Belt and Road Initiative (BRI) and to build a community of shared destiny.
China's top political advisory body started its annual session here, vowing to take on new mission for the country's goal toward a "great modern socialist country." The BRI is on the top of the session’s agenda.
According to the political observers here, Pakistan is an important country in the region and it has assumed special position due to China-Pakistan Economic Corridor (CPEC). The CPEC is major and pilot project of the BRI.
Yu Zhengsheng, Chairman of the 12th Chinese People's Political Consultative Conference (CPPCC) National Committee, delivered a work report to 2,149 political advisors who gathered to discuss major political, economic and social issues in the world's most populous nation and second largest economy.
"We will deep the CPPCC's ties with our friends from abroad, promote the implementation of Belt and Road Initiative and contribute to the building of a community with shared future for humanity", he said.
"We developed extensive ties with our friends, contributing to creating a favourable external environment. “We engaged in a pragmatic high level exchanges with contacts abroad and promoted cooperation in building Belt and Road Initiative and increasing complementarity between the development strategies of China and other countries along the routes", Yu Zhengsheng said while discussing the achievements of CPPCC National Committee. "We will focus our advice and efforts on the main issues in securing a decisive victory in building a moderately prosperous society in all respects and embarking on a journey to fully build a modern socialist China," Yu said.
